AI Technical Summary

Technical Problem

During use of existing diabetes care blood collection devices, medical staff need to frequently replace blood collection needles, resulting in a high risk of needle stick injuries and inconvenient operation.

Method used

A blood collection device including an auxiliary mechanism is designed. Through the cooperation of a limit block, a magnet and a protective tube, the blood collection needle body can be quickly replaced and protected to avoid needle stick injuries.

Benefits of technology

The rapid replacement of blood collection needles is achieved, the risk of medical staff being stabbed is reduced, and operational efficiency and safety are improved.

Abstract

The utility model discloses a diabetes nursing hemostix capable of quickly replacing a blood taking needle, which relates to the technical field of hemostix, and comprises a vacuum tube, a first rubber plug and a tail needle, the top end of the vacuum tube is connected with the first rubber plug, the inside of the first rubber plug is in butt joint with the tail needle, and the top end of the tail needle is connected with a catheter. When the diabetes nursing hemostix with the blood taking needle capable of being rapidly replaced is used, limiting of the blood taking needle body or the vacuum tube is canceled through the auxiliary mechanism, then the assembly can be replaced only by moving the assembly up and down, and time and energy are saved; and the blood taking needle main body is displayed or covered by moving the protective cylinder, so that medical personnel are prevented from being punctured by the blood taking needle during blood taking, and the sleeve taken down by the medical personnel does not need to be lost, so that when the blood taking device for diabetes nursing is used, the effects of conveniently replacing components and preventing the needle from being punctured are achieved.

TECHNICAL FIELD

[0001] The utility model relates to blood collector technical field, concretely is a kind of blood collector for diabetes care of quick replacement blood needle. BACKGROUND

[0002] Diabetes care refers to a series of measures and activities aimed at helping diabetes patients manage their condition, prevent complications and maintain good quality of life. Diabetes patients need to monitor blood glucose levels regularly in daily care, and blood collector is an important tool to complete this process. Choosing the right blood collector is crucial to reduce pain, improve blood collection efficiency and ensure measurement accuracy.

[0003] In order to nurse the diabetes patients, when the patient is blood-collected by the blood collector, first, the tail needle penetrates the first rubber plug, then the blood collector needle body is inserted into the patient's vein, and then the blood flows into the vacuum tube through the catheter, completing the collection of blood. However, during the use of the blood collector, the medical staff needs to replace the blood collector needle for each patient. However, the medical staff often needs to replace the needle several times during a round of blood collection, which can easily cause the medical staff to be pricked by the blood collector needle, thereby affecting the use of the blood collector for diabetes care. [0021] In specific implementation, in order to nurse the diabetic patient, when the patient is blood sampled by the blood sampler, the protective cylinder 811 is first manually pushed to move the protective cylinder 811 along the fixed cylinder 809 to the direction close to the limiting seat 6, because the fixed cylinder 809 is connected with the limiting block 810, the movement of the fixed cylinder 809 is guided by the limiting block 810 at this time, until the head of the blood sampling needle body 7 penetrates the second rubber plug 812, at this time, the patient is blood sampled by using the blood sampling needle body 7, after the blood sampling is completed, the protective cylinder 811 is pushed again, until the protective cylinder 811 covers the blood sampling needle body 7, thereby preventing the medical staff from being pricked by the blood sampling needle during blood sampling, and there is no need to worry about the loss of the cannula taken off by the medical staff;

[0022] When the blood sampling needle needs to be replaced, the limiting seat 6 is only moved downward, because the limiting seat 6 is connected with the iron fixing piece 807, until the iron fixing piece 807 is disconnected with the magnet piece 808, the used blood sampling needle body 7 can be taken off, and in the subsequent process, the limiting seat 6 is only connected with the limiting head 5 by moving upward, and then the iron fixing piece 807 is attached to the magnet piece 808, at this time, the iron fixing piece 807 and the magnet piece 808 are connected by magnetic attraction, and then the limiting seat 6 is fixed, so that the replacement of the blood sampling needle body 7 can be completed by only moving the limiting seat 6 upward and downward, thereby saving time and effort;

[0023] When the vacuum tube 1 needs to be disconnected with the tail needle 3, the extending belt 806 is first pulled to move the pull rod 804, because the pull rod 804 is connected with the fixing piece 805, the movement of the pull rod 804 will move the fixing piece 805 together, until the fixing piece 805 is disconnected with the first rubber plug 2, thereby canceling the limiting of the vacuum tube 1, at this time, the medical staff only needs to move the fixed seat 801 upward to take out the vacuum tube 1 alone, and the friction force is increased by the anti-skid strip 803 to assist the medical staff to move the fixed seat 801, and the transparent observation strip 802 is convenient for the medical staff to observe the blood collection condition in the vacuum tube 1 through the fixed seat 801, and finally, the diabetes nursing blood sampler plays the roles of facilitating the replacement of components and preventing the needle from pricking in use.
